## Deployment

The Marrowlight relevance-tuning notes ship alongside the Quernsearch service and are read at boot, not hot-reloaded, so a redeploy is required after any weight change. Reviewers: check that boost factors stay within the agreed bounds and that synonym sets were regenerated from the Pellwick corpus. Canary deploys go to the Harrowgate cluster first; promote only after click-through metrics hold for 24 hours. The deployed instance runs with the configuration below.

service settings:
PRAIX_LOG_LEVEL=error
PRAIX_METRICS_HOST=metrics.praix.qorvelcorp.corp
PRAIX_POOL_SIZE=16

### Step 3: Update your dispatcher config

LiftLogic 7 changes how plugins register with the elevator-dispatch simulator. The old global hook is gone — your plugin now declares its dispatch strategy in the simulator config instead of patching the scheduler at runtime. Yes, this means one more file to edit, but crash-on-reload is finally fixed. Start from the default simulator configuration shown below.

settings of tagef-bawif:
DRUIX_HOST=druix.zemvarlabs.internal
DRUIX_PORT=8000

**Vendor note: Inkmill markdown pipeline**

Rendering for Parchway docs is outsourced to Inkmill under an annual contract, renewing each March. They handle sanitization and PDF export; we own the upload queue. SLA: 4-hour response on rendering failures. Escalate only after two failed retries. Their support desk is reachable at the address below.

billing contact of hahaf-baguf = zorael.tammir.jorius@sivrelhq.internal